What Does Strong Local SEO Actually Look Like for a CPA Firm?
Local SEO for a CPA practice is not just about stuffing a city name onto a webpage. It is a combination of technical site health, authoritative content, consistent local citations, and a Google Business Profile that signals trustworthiness to both the algorithm and the prospective client reading your listing at 9 p.m.
Google Business Profile Optimization
Your Google Business Profile is the first thing a potential client sees before they ever visit your website. For CPA firms in the Edison area, this means accurate NAP (name, address, phone number) data, a complete list of services — bookkeeping, tax preparation, business advisory, payroll — and a steady stream of recent client reviews. Firms that respond to reviews and post updates during key periods like January through April earn higher local pack rankings and more clicks.
Service Pages That Answer Real Questions
A homepage and a contact form are not enough. Google wants to see dedicated pages for each service you offer, written for the audience you serve. A page targeting small business owners in Edison is different from one targeting high-net-worth individuals in nearby Woodbridge or New Brunswick. Each page should address the specific concerns of that audience, answer the questions they actually type into search engines, and include a clear call to action.
Citation Building and NAP Consistency
Listings on platforms like Yelp, the NJCPA directory, Avvo (for dual-licensed professionals), and local chamber sites such as the Edison Chamber of Commerce reinforce your location signals. Inconsistent addresses or outdated phone numbers across these platforms confuse Google and suppress your rankings. An audit of your existing citations is usually one of the fastest wins available.
The Edison Market: Local Factors That Shape Your SEO Strategy
Edison Township is home to one of the largest South Asian communities in the United States, concentrated largely along Oak Tree Road in the Iselin and Menlo Park neighborhoods. A significant portion of the local client base includes small business owners, medical professionals, and technology workers who may prefer bilingual service or firms experienced with international tax considerations like FBAR filings and Form 8938. CPA firms that reflect this local reality in their content — without resorting to stereotypes — often capture long-tail search traffic that generalist competitors miss entirely.
Seasonality also shapes search behavior here. New Jersey’s tax deadline for S-corps and partnerships typically aligns with federal schedules, but the state’s unique Business Alternative Income Tax (BAIT) election — a workaround for the federal SALT deduction cap — generates a spike in searches from business owners in Edison, Piscataway, and South Plainfield between October and December. CPA firms that publish timely, accurate content around these dates capture high-intent traffic that converts into actual engagements.
The Raritan Center Parkway and the commercial real estate corridor near the Turnpike interchange (Exit 10) house a large number of small manufacturers, logistics companies, and service businesses that need ongoing accounting support. Targeting location-specific keywords tied to these commercial zones can bring in commercial clients with higher lifetime value than individual tax filers.

What to Look for When Hiring an SEO Agency as a CPA Firm
Not every agency understands the specific compliance considerations and reputation sensitivity that come with marketing a financial services firm. According to Google’s Search Central documentation, quality content and trustworthiness are foundational ranking signals — and for a CPA firm, that means demonstrating credentials, publishing accurate and useful financial guidance, and maintaining a clean, professional digital presence.
Watch for agencies that promise guaranteed rankings on a specific timeline. SEO results depend on competition, domain age, content quality, and dozens of other variables. A credible agency gives you a realistic roadmap, measurable milestones, and transparent reporting. Ask specifically about their experience with professional services firms in New Jersey, their process for building local citations, and how they handle content that touches on tax or financial topics — where accuracy matters and errors can damage your reputation.
– Do they have documented case studies or client results from comparable markets?
– Can they explain the technical audit process in plain language?
– Do they understand NJCPA advertising guidelines and what CPA firms can and cannot claim in marketing materials?
Frequently Asked Questions: SEO for CPA Firms in Menlo Park, Edison
How long does SEO take to show results for a CPA firm in Edison, NJ?
Most CPA firms in competitive markets like Menlo Park, Edison begin seeing measurable ranking improvements within three to six months of consistent SEO work. Full map pack visibility and steady inbound lead flow typically develop over six to twelve months, depending on how competitive the target keywords are and the starting condition of the website.
Is local SEO different from general SEO for accounting firms?
Yes. Local SEO focuses specifically on appearing in geographically relevant searches — “CPA near me,” “tax accountant Edison NJ,” and similar queries. It involves optimizing your Google Business Profile, building local citations, earning reviews, and creating location-specific content. General SEO covers broader keyword visibility but is less directly tied to driving local phone calls and appointment requests.
What keywords should a CPA firm in Menlo Park, Edison target?
High-value starting points include service-plus-location combinations like “small business CPA Edison NJ,” “tax preparation Menlo Park,” “bookkeeping services Edison,” and “BAIT election New Jersey CPA.” Long-tail queries tied to specific industries common in the area — such as “accountant for medical practice Edison” or “CPA for tech workers New Jersey” — often convert at a higher rate because the searcher’s intent is very specific.
How important are Google reviews for a CPA firm’s local rankings?
Reviews are a significant local ranking factor and an even more significant trust signal for prospective clients choosing between firms. A consistent flow of recent, specific reviews — mentioning the services provided and the location — helps both your map pack position and your conversion rate when someone lands on your profile. Responding to every review, positive or negative, reinforces your credibility.

What does an SEO audit for a CPA firm typically include?
A comprehensive audit covers technical site health (page speed, crawlability, mobile usability), on-page optimization review, keyword gap analysis against local competitors, Google Business Profile assessment, citation consistency check, and an evaluation of existing content quality. The audit output gives you a prioritized action list with the highest-impact items identified first.
